French Goalkeeper: We Respect Morocco Very Much, Look Forward to Win Game

Doha, December 13 (QNA) - The French goalkeeper Hugo Hadrien Dominique Lloris said that the game with the Moroccan team at Al Bayt Stadium in the semi-finals of the F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022 will be difficult.

In a press conference before the launch of the game, Lloris said that he is looking forward to playing with his friends, adding that the game is between two powerful teams that enjoy more talents, specially that they strive for triumph to reach the finals.

Lloris added that he strongly appreciates the accomplishment made by Morocco to reach this stage, because the victory was not merely an improvisation.

Morocco has already beaten strong teams in previous matches, most notably Belgium, Canada, Spain and Portugal,he said, indicating that his team focuses on training and recovery, because it includes veteran and young footballers who have skills and talents, along with determination and strengths.

The focus shall be on the preparation and maintaining the calmness to offer best performance at the stadium with physical and psychological power to score more goals, he said.
The French goalkeeper added that the Moroccan team has strong defense and is good in counter-attacks with coherent midfield. (QNA)
